A rumoured Intel Nova Lake mobile chip that's 100% E-cores with a beefy iGPU would be great news for handhelds, if…

Rumors suggest Intel's upcoming Nova Lake mobile chips may feature an all-E-core design with a powerful integrated GPU, potentially benefiting handheld gaming PCs. However, the chip is reportedly intended for edge computing applications, and high DRAM prices could make such a handheld unfeasibly expensive.

Qualcomm's new Arduino Ventuno Q is an AI-focused computer designed for robotics

Qualcomm has announced the Arduino Ventuno Q, a new AI-focused single-board computer designed for robotics and edge AI applications. It features Qualcomm's Dragonwing IQ8 processor with a dedicated AI accelerator, capable of 40 TOPs, and includes 16GB of RAM and 64GB of storage. The device supports offline AI model execution and aims to make advanced robotics and edge AI more accessible.
